| I went to college at the University of Florida and spent many a leisurely weekend tubing the Santa Fe river while camping at Ginnie Springs. Camping, drinking, hanging out with friends...good times. The area around Ginnie Springs is famous for the cave system that many scuba divers come to check out. Some of the best cave divers in the world live near this particular cave system. I had the unfortunate coincidence of diving on a weekend where a recovery tool place. A cave diver got turned around, lost, ran out of air and died. The state of his fingers and the note to his family written on his slate were enough to convince me that I NEVER needed to do any cave diving.
